The BNY Mellon Municipal Bond Infrastructure Fund, Inc. is a closed-end investment vehicle specializing in fixed income, operating under the guidance of BNY Mellon Investment Adviser, Inc. The fund primarily allocates capital to tax-exempt, investment-grade debt instruments issued within the United States. These securities originate from states, U.S. territories, the District of Columbia, their various political subdivisions, agencies, instrumentalities, or multistate authorities, alongside other specific eligible assets. A significant portion of its portfolio targets the infrastructure sector, encompassing transportation, energy, utilities, social infrastructure, and water and environmental projects, among other public sectors. To be included, bonds must possess an investment-grade rating of at least BBB- from S&P and Fitch, or Baa3 from Moody's, and the fund maintains an effective duration ceiling of 14 years. Utilizing a comprehensive investment strategy, the fund combines fundamental and quantitative analysis with a bottom-up security selection methodology. Its objective is to capitalize on pricing disparities within the municipal bond market by assessing the relative value and appeal of diverse sectors and individual securities. Portfolio construction involves active adjustments across sectors, driven by factors such as prevailing economic and monetary conditions, interest rate trends, general money market dynamics, municipal bond market status, the size and maturity of specific offerings, and credit ratings. Founded on April 25, 2013, and domiciled in the United States, the fund was previously known as Dreyfus Municipal Bond Infrastructure Fund, Inc.
